Lumber dealers and building supply companies across northern Illinois, northwest Indiana and southeast Wisconsin now have easy access to a national brand of cellular PVC architectural trim, thanks to a new distribution agreement between VERSATEX Trimboard and Parksite Inc.
Starting in November, Parksite will distribute the full line of VERSATEX Trimboard products, such as trimboards, sheet, bead board, and mouldings, and all proprietary specialty items, such as the innovative VERSATEX soffit system. Parksite’s Illinois distribution center in Bolingbrook will facilitate regional distribution.
Headquartered in Batavia, Ill., Parksite is an employee-owned company that provides direct sales, market development and distribution services throughout the building materials supply chain across the eastern half of the United States.
